An acid solution of `pH=6` is diluted `1000` times, the `pH` of the final solution isA. `6.99`B. `6.0`C. `3.0`D. `9.0` |
|
Answer» Correct Answer - A `pH= 6 means [H^(+)]=10^(-6) M`. After dilution, the hydrogen ion concentration becomes `10^(-9) M`. Under such conditions, the hydrogen ions obtained from water cannot be neglected. ` :.` Total `[H^(+)]=10^(-9)+10^(-7)` (approx). ` =10^(-7)(10^(-2)+1)=10^(-7) (1.01)` [The contribution of `H^(+)` from water will not be exactly `10^(-7)` but still we can make an approximation in an objective problem and take it as `10^(-7)`] `pH= -log[H^(+)]= -1.01xx10^(-7)=7-0.0043=6.9957` |
